How to make the stretcher of the distribution on the "Niva" with your own hands

Despite the fact that every year in Russia more and more new roads are being laid, off-road in our regions is enough. Domestic motorists sometimes have to travel to such areas, where only an armored personnel carrier can travel. That is why in the conditions of rough terrain there is a need for the availability of adequate transport. The cheapest and affordable SUV for today is VAZ 2121 "Niva". But this Russian all-terrain vehicle is subject to various damages. One of the weak points is the transfer case. In order to protect it, motorists install a special stretcher of the distribution on the "Niva". With his hands it is made or not, it does not matter - the result is still the same (the difference is only in monetary costs).

What is this element for?

The subframe of the distribution on the "Niva" with its own hands is installed in order to prevent the occurrence of vibrations and resonance, and, of course, to protect the box from all sorts of damages. According to car owners, after installation of the device in the car, the noise level is significantly reduced, which, unfortunately, can not be ruled out by any modern soundproofing.

Benefits of using

Such an adaptation, like a stretcher, has a lot of advantages, the main one of which, as we have already noted, is the reduction of noise and vibrations in the cabin. In addition, this device is the only protection of the lower part of the transfer case.

By the way, on the conveyor "Niva" is already supplied with special fixings to the floor, which allow mounting mounts on the transfer case. Thus, the installation of the subframe of the distribution on the "Niva" takes away from the car enthusiast no more than 30 minutes. Another thing is the hand-made manufacturing of this part (in this case it can take several days to work). But why is the machine not initially equipped with such a device? To answer this question, let us consider the main shortcomings of this device.

disadvantages

The main disadvantage of the subframe is the decrease in the vehicle's ground clearance (by several centimeters). But nevertheless on off-road ability of an off-road car this upgrade practically does not affect. Most likely, the absence of the element under consideration in the factory equipment of the car is explained by a complex production technology (special structural steel is used for the manufacture of this device ). However, no matter how many reasons we call, the fact remains that the subframe of the distribution on the "Niva" is established only by the efforts of the car owners themselves. Even in SRT, not everyone is taken for their manufacture or installation.

How does the car behave on the road?

Judging by the reviews of motorists, the stretcher under the distribution ("Niva 2121") is really useful and functional detail: at a speed of more than 100 kilometers per hour, no vibrations and noises that were earlier in the cabin are not observed. Of course, the inside is not as quiet as in the restyling "Skoda Octavia", but still the difference is palpable.

We make the subframe of the distribution on the "Niva" with our own hands

First you need to prepare a metal channel and corner. The role of fasteners will be carried out by 4 bolts, which we screw through the spars through to the interior. Place the screws in such a way that they affect part of the seats and are strictly underneath them. We also need a sheet of thin metal.

Required Tools

First of all, prepare a large and small grinder, a drill (preferably not a rechargeable battery), a caliper, a roll, a hammer, a ruler, as well as a means of protection to prevent the ingress of hot metal shavings into the eyes while working with the bulgarian. All work should be carried out according to a certain scheme (drawing of the stretcher of the distribution "Niva 2121" you can see in the photo below).

So, where to start work? First you need to measure and process the base edge of the channel. After that, measure the necessary distances from it with a ruler. The windows in the device need to be sawed out by a small and large bulgarian in the transverse and longitudinal direction, respectively. The length of the cut should not exceed 8 millimeters from the edge of the upper shelf of the structure. After the windows have been cut, the contours of the sides should be machined and the chamfers removed.

The angle of attachment to the spar and cross member of the device may be free, but it should not be less than the length of the fastening holes and the distance between them. If there are no corners available, you can use a different fastening scheme for the part to the spar. It is important to observe the height of fastening to the subframe of the transfer case.

If this is a reinforced subframe, metal corners are additionally welded under the mounting points of the brackets of the box. The latter are connected to the lateral parts of the channel. The holes of the oblong form go like a bolted joint.

We install the subframes of the distribution on the "Niva Comfort" off-road vehicle: where is the protection secured?

It is mounted on the corners at the bottom of the device. With regard to the type of connection, it, like the two above options, is bolted. However, the holes in the body of the side parts of the device and the lower part of the corners are made on a threaded principle. Protective sheet - part of the power structure, which forms a kind of box and gives the subframe greater strength. Accordingly, the box will be less vulnerable to various mechanical damages, which will be positively displayed on the passability of the "Niva".

Extra holes

Under the drain plug, the oil drainage window is additionally cut out. Drilling holes can be in any place convenient for you, without bothering with the accuracy of the layout. Also, motorists make technological windows to drain the water formed between the sides of the channel and the dirt that gets there. The protection is enhanced by the corners, which are attached to the support of the box and the frontal part of the whole device. Such a design will save the distribution from all sorts of blows to stumps, ditches and other obstacles that can lead to deformation of the subframe.

How can I improve the device for extreme driving?

In this case, you can change the profile of the sidewalls of the device, which will make it more flat and durable. The corners are welded not only to the brackets of the transfer box, but also to the side shelves of the channel. They are also fastened inside the last element. At the exit you should get a frame from four corners. This design makes it possible to cut the sidewalls of the channel under the shelf of the corner. As a result, the height of the subframe will be reduced by 50%, and the strength will be doubled.
